Background:
- Stanford University Medical Center's cardiac transplant program data from 1968-1976 is analyzed.
- The study reassesses the role of cardiac transplantation in treating end-stage cardiac disease.
Purpose of the Study:
- To evaluate the long-term survival and functional outcomes of cardiac transplant recipients.
- To identify barriers to post-transplantation survival and rehabilitation.
Main Methods:
- Retrospective analysis of 109 cardiac transplant patients between January 1968 and August 1976.
- Survival rates (1- and 2-year) were calculated for the entire cohort and for 3-month survivors.
- Functional status was assessed using the New York Heart Association (NYHA) cardiac status classification.
Main Results:
- Overall 1- and 2-year survival rates were 52% and 43%, respectively.
- For 69 patients surviving over 3 months, 1- and 2-year survival rates improved to 80% and 66%.
- 90% of 3-month survivors achieved NYHA Class I status and returned to pre-illness activities. Patients awaiting transplants without donors had poor outcomes (38/40 died within 6 months).
Conclusions:
- Cardiac transplantation significantly prolongs survival in carefully selected patients with end-stage cardiac disease.
- Successful transplantation can restore recipients to an active, functional life.
- Steroid-related immunosuppression complications remain a primary challenge for long-term survival and rehabilitation.
Abstract:
The current status of the human cardiac transplant experience at Stanford University Medical Center is presented in order to reassess its role in the treatment of end-stage cardiac disease. Of 109 patients undergoing transplantation at Stanford between January 1968 and August 1976, 44 were still alive as of August 1, 1976. The overall 1- and 2-year survival rates for the series are 52% and 43%, respectively. Sixty-nine patients have survived more than 3 months, and their overall 1- and 2-year survival rates are 80% and 66%, respectively. Of the 3-month survivors, 62 (90%) returned to functional Class I New York Heart Association cardiac status and most of these returned to their pre-illness activities. Of 40 patients selected for transplantation for whom a donor did not become available, 38 were dead in less than 6 months. Complications related to immunosuppression with steroids are currently the major barrier to longer survival and improved rehabilitation postransplantation. On the basis of these data we conclude that cardiac transplantation not only prolongs survival, but can return carefully selected recipients to an active life.
